site stats

Natural key database definition

Webprimary key (primary keyword): A primary key, also called a primary keyword, is a key in a relational database that is unique for each record. It is a unique identifier, such as a driver license number, telephone number (including area code), or vehicle identification number (VIN). A relational database must always have one and only one ... Web29 de sept. de 2013 · Surrogate keys typically require additional storage and indexing and by definition require additional uniqueness constraints. Surrogates require additional processing to map the external natural key values onto their surrogates and vice versa. Now compare this potential query: A. SELECT t2.NaturalTable2Key, …

Database Definition, Types, & Facts Britannica

WebKey People: database, also called electronic database, any collection of data, or information, that is specially organized for rapid search and retrieval by a computer. Databases are structured to facilitate the storage, retrieval, modification, and deletion of data in conjunction with various data-processing operations. WebWhether to use natural or surrogate keys is a long-debated subject of database design. I am a fan of using natural keys. I think there are even more compelling reasons to use … hub firms翻译 https://anywhoagency.com

Does a table with a surrogate key require a unique constraint on a ...

Web6 filas · 26 de sept. de 2024 · It can be a natural key, surrogate key, or a composite key. Using our earlier examples, ... This video explains how to install Oracle Express, which is the database we’ll be … SQL, and database development in general, ... DDL stands for Data … Can the Database Update Multiple Tables as Part of the MERGE Statement? No, … A foreign key is a column in one table that refers to the primary key in another … What is an SQL Stored Procedure: the definition and what’s included or … I use a range of tools and resources as part of my day job and running Database … Software development, software testing, business analysis, database … You have an issue accessing or using Database Star Academy (you can email … WebThe good news is that as I show in The Process of Database Refactoring it is possible, albeit it may require a bit of work, to replace a natural key with a surrogate key (or vice … http://agiledata.org/essays/keys.html hub firmware eh1 and 2

What is a Primary Key? - Definition from Techopedia

Category:Why use a "business key" and a "primary key"? - SearchOracle

Tags:Natural key database definition

Natural key database definition

10 tips for choosing between a surrogate and natural primary key

Web19 de nov. de 2024 · A Business Key satisfying the four conditions above can serve as the Primary Key (PK) for the entity/table. ‘. It is just because of this that the BK can act in …

Natural key database definition

Did you know?

Web30 de may. de 2024 · This post presents 16 key database concepts and their corresponding concise, straightforward definitions. The selection of terms for this topic is especially difficult, so a whole host of reasons. Suffice it to say that these 16 concepts do not adequately represent all important terminology related to databases. Web16 de ago. de 2008 · This research seeks the definition and thematic mapping of landscape units and its potential for ecotourism. The area of study includes regions of the municipal districts of Capitólio, São João Batista do Glória and São José de Barra, in the region of medium Rio Grande, in Minas Gerais, Brazil, an area of immense potential for ecotourism.

Web18 de feb. de 2024 · There’s a subtle, but critical, difference between the two notions business-unique key and primary key in a relational database.For example, in a “users” table, the “user_id” could be the primary key while the “email_address” (which must be not null and unique) could be the business-unique key. The columns that implement each … Web10 de nov. de 2024 · Quick definitions Surrogate key = Artificial key generated internally that has no real meaning outside the Db (e.g. a UniqueIdentifier or Int with Identity property set etc.). Implemented in SQL Sevrver by Primary Key Constraints on a column(s). Natural key = uniquely identifies an instance (or record) using real meaningful data as provided …

WebThe good news is that as I show in The Process of Database Refactoring it is possible, albeit it may require a bit of work, to replace a natural key with a surrogate key (or vice versa). To replace a natural key with a surrogate you would apply the Introduce Surrogate Key refactoring, as you see depicted in Figure 2 to replace the key of the Order table. Web11 de abr. de 2024 · Apache Arrow is a technology widely adopted in big data, analytics, and machine learning applications. In this article, we share F5’s experience with Arrow, specifically its application to telemetry, and the challenges we encountered while optimizing the OpenTelemetry protocol to significantly reduce bandwidth costs. The promising …

http://agiledata.org/essays/keys.html

Web9 de may. de 2009 · Users should never see them on reports, they should never be able to look up rows with them, etc. In addition, you should have a natural key, which by definition must be unique. That uniqueness should be enforced in your data model. My current client has decided that it's going to merge several entities in their database. hogwarts rucksackWeb23 de mar. de 2011 · 4: Primary key values should be stable. A primary key must be stable. You’re not supposed to change a primary key value. Unfortunately, for that rule, data isn’t stable. In addition, natural ... hogwarts rundgangWeb23 de may. de 2024 · Natural keys are formed from the business attributes we identify for an entity type. They form part of the vocabulary the users would employ while discussing these entities. They arise "naturally" in discussion: hence the name. Any combination of such attributes that respect the rules of normalisation can form a natural key. hogwarts salesWeb29 de ago. de 2016 · Narrow – Same reasoning as above. Smaller = faster. Unique – Primary keys have to be unique anyway but this helps with the Narrow requirement. If the clustered index wasn’t unique a 4 byte uniqueifier has to be added. Static – Every time a value clustered index has to be changed the data has to be moved. hogwarts sallowUsage of natural keys as unique identifiers in a table has one main disadvantage which is the change of business rules or the change of rules of the attribute in the real world. The definition of the structure of the natural key attribute might change in the future. For example if there is a table storing the information about US citizens, the Social Security Number would act as the natural key, Social Security Number being the natural key might pose … hub first legoWeb16 de abr. de 2024 · A surrogate key is a system generated (could be GUID, sequence, unique identifier, etc.) value with no business meaning that is used to uniquely identify a … hogwarts savedWeb14 de ago. de 2024 · Primary Key: A primary key is a special relational database table column (or combination of columns) designated to uniquely identify all table records. A … hubfit prices